Output ebf9d8d909e94bb9d10b78c81ae942cd1c36c5a036150ec3ea6fae8aa226d6fb:3

value
631150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 613fd9fa60b2f9b42143887561c672eb87834469 OP_EQUAL
address
3AZDxdUWPC3r2Jyathoyt9xaN1BYVQ6wdV
transaction
ebf9d8d909e94bb9d10b78c81ae942cd1c36c5a036150ec3ea6fae8aa226d6fb
confirmations
143068
spent
true